Cultural Collateral: Selections from the Permanent Collection

Tuscaloosa – The Sarah Moody Gallery of Art presents Cultural Collateral: Selections from the Permanent Collection, January 9-February 14, 2020. Each year the Sarah Moody Gallery of Art produces an exhibition that features selections from its Permanent Collection of contemporary art, a unique and valuable resource to the communities of UA and West Alabama. The Permanent Collection dates back to the 1950s and currently numbers over 1,600 works of contemporary art by international, national and regional artists. The selections reflect the variety of contemporary artistic styles, materials and approaches found in the collection.
